The Hong Kong Museum of History, located in China, offers a comprehensive journey through the territory’s past, spanning from 400 million years ago to the 1997 handover. Spread across eight galleries, the museum houses a wealth of exhibits, artifacts, life-size dioramas, and multimedia displays. These elements collectively illustrate the natural, archaeological, ethnographic, cultural, and local history of Hong Kong. Visitors can explore the diverse aspects of the region’s development, gaining a deeper understanding of its rich and varied heritage.
